“NCIS” Season 16 will only involve a pure military investigation as Gibbs (Mark Harmon) and his crew will be looking into the unusual friendly-fire deaths that have been happening overseas. Although cases like this tend to happen, higher-ups seem to be convinced that someone is orchestrating these mishaps, The Daily Express reported.
While showrunners aren’t providing any major details as to what will occur in the next episode of “NCIS” Season 16, the story appears to be similar to “Jack Reacher: Never Go Back.” It can be recalled that this film also involved the murder of two military personnel although their case wasn’t a friendly fire.
Instead, the deaths were considered as a straight-up gun-down and were placed on the shoulders of Major Susan Turner (Colbie Smulders). Long story short, the major was framed by the one who was truly responsible for the killings and was found to be selling weapons to insurgents and is dealing in the drug trade. The upcoming episode of “NCIS” Season 16 might very well have the same story to tell.
After all, if a soldier discovers a major violation of his comrade, the wrongdoer can simply wait until a fight breaks out before gunning down his victim and pretending to have misfired. Of course, this is just speculation at this point and “NCIS” Season 16 Episode 8 might very well take on a different path.
Whatever the case, this could be an interesting episode for the Naval Criminal Investigative Service, especially since Veterans Days was recently celebrated. On another note, fans are also waiting for the shocking development this midseason of “NCIS” Season 16 as there will be a major shakeup in the overarching plotline of the series.
The change in question is the upcoming feud between Gibbs and the Secretary of Defense. The friction stems from the fact that somewhere along “NCIS” Season 16, Gibbs will disobey his superior’s orders leading to an inside investigation of the team.
This development is also speculated to cause a member of the crew to lose his or her position, which means an important character will be leaving the series. If so, this will mark the second time that a beloved member of the squad is put on the chopping block this installment. As for when “NCIS” Season 16 Episode 8 will air, “Friendly Fire” will be released on Nov. 20.
